NYKMentality wrote:We're all seeing it. And we all understand that Shumpert's returning from ACL surgery, we're not trying to throw Shumpert into the line of fire but at the same time, Shumpert has started all 14 games, but at the SF position. Lets slide Carmelo back to his natural postion of SF while moving Shumpert down to the 2G position. At this point, I'm willing to start either J.R Smith or even James White at 2G if Woodson's not ready to slide Shumpert down to the 2G position.

All of this is a moot point, but we need Jason Kidd on the bench sooner rather than later. During Kidd's previous 10 games he's only put up 21 points. Hasn't scored a single point during his previous 2 games. Only 3 points during his previous 3 games. Has only averaged 2.1 points, 1.9 assists, 2.5 rebounds, 1.1 steals and 21.1 minutes per game during his previous 10 games. Has only shot 7/39 during his previous 10 games.

This is unacceptable from a starting 2G.

It's time to see Felton, Shumpert, Melo, Stoudemire and Chandler as our starting 5.

If Woodson's not ready to start Stoudemire at PF then go with Felton, Shumpert, Melo, Kurt Thomas and Tyson Chandler.

If we're trying to keep Kurt Thomas rested for the postseason, then go with Felton, Shumpert, Copeland at SF, Melo and Chandler.

I'm even willing to watch us go with Felton, White, Shumpert, Melo and Chandler.

Man, we could even get better production going with Felton, Shumpert, Novak, Melo and Chandler.

But, Kidd only averaging 2.1 points, 1.9 assists, 2.5 boards and 1.1 steals during 21.1 minutes per game during his previous 10 games, along with only 7/39 during his past 10 games? It's hurting us. I'm a supporter of Woodson, but he needs to bench Jason Kidd and give our offense a much better chance at success moving forward.

And the bold is what we get.

@HowardBeckNYT wrote:James White will start tonight, replacing Kidd. Woodson said he prefers Kidd w/ball in his hands, so he's effectively the backup PG now.

James White replacing Kidd at 2G was my last option. Would've rather seen Melo slide down to SF while Shump slid down to 2G and/or J.R replacing Kidd as our starting 2G, but, I was also a fan of giving White a chance at starting over an aging Kidd. This is great news moving forward, because we need Jason Kidd fresh and ready to go come postseason play.

It took a while, but credit to Woodson for finally making a change. I haven't seen too much of White, but he seems very athletic and if we get A.) Tough perimeter defense and B.) Limited amount of turnovers out of White? I'm all for this move.
